Tegan Gabrielse is one of the top pitchers in the Class of 2025, but she’s also a standout catcher who was photographed at the D9 tournament this fall warming up the pitcher as the sun broke over the horizon.

Tegan Gabrielse of the Virginia Unity – Johnson 14U team is a Top 25 pitcher in the 2025 Extra Elite 100 who loves to catch too.

At the D9 tournament in Orlando, Florida on October 24, 2020, she was warming up her friend and teammate Kadyn Campber when Tegan’s father, Alex Gabrielse, took this beautiful photo at 7:43 am before a game with the Ohio-Hawks 06 – Joseforsky.

As Tegan recalls: “I was warming up my pitcher because there’s nothing better than trusting someone to have your back and understands you. Being best friends and working as a battery, knowing what they do, sets them up for success. And that is what makes the team better.”

The talented young athlete is a pretty good catcher as she didn’t allow a passed ball in 22 innings this fall and gave up just four stolen bases. She can hit too, smashing five home runs in the fall, but the former Select 30 standout is primarily known for her pitching abilities thanks to her ability to throw effectively in the 60’s.
